mysql
文章平均质量分 94
欢迎来到《深入MySQL数据库》专栏,这是一个专注于深度研究MySQL数据库的平台。MySQL作为一款流行的关系型数据库管理系统,在众多应用场景中都发挥着关键作用。本专栏将深入探讨MySQL的核心概念、高级特性、性能优化以及实际应用,帮助您充分利用MySQL构建稳健、高效的数据存储系统。
一只牛博
快来面对我~~~
展开
-
面试官:left join后用on还是where?区别真的很大!
在 SQL 查询优化中,条件放置的位置至关重要。究竟是将条件放在连接条件中,还是放在 WHERE 子句中,可能会显著影响查询的性能和结果。本文将深入探讨这两种方法的区别,揭示各自的优势与劣势,帮助开发者在实际应用中做出最佳选择。原创 2024-09-04 13:04:00 · 1065 阅读 · 0 评论 -
mysql中的explain居然也会骗人
mysql中的explain居然也会骗人原创 2024-08-27 12:42:32 · 15321 阅读 · 0 评论 -
从新手到高手:彻底掌握MySQL表死锁
本文将深入探讨MySQL数据库中的表死锁问题,包括死锁的成因、检测方法以及解决方案。通过实际案例分析,帮助读者理解并有效预防和处理MySQL表死锁问题,提高数据库性能和可靠性。原创 2024-06-27 18:43:10 · 15925 阅读 · 0 评论 -
从删库到还原
误操作导致删库,进行还原原创 2024-06-25 12:38:06 · 16252 阅读 · 0 评论 -
揭秘SQL中的公用表表达式:数据查询的新宠儿
本文将详细介绍SQL中的公用表表达式(Common Table Expressions,简称CTE)。CTE是一种在SQL查询中临时命名结果集的方法,它简化了查询复杂度,提高代码的易用性和可维护性论文提出CTE的基本概念和语法开始,逐步介绍电位CTE和非电位CTE的用法,并通过实际案例展示CTE在数据查询和处理中的强大功能。原创 2024-05-29 12:17:13 · 15678 阅读 · 0 评论 -
解密MySQL二进制日志:深度探究mysqlbinlog工具
本文将深入研究MySQL二进制日志(binary log)以及其解析工具mysqlbinlog。我们将探索mysqlbinlog工具的功能、用法和原理,并通过实例演示如何使用mysqlbinlog解析和分析MySQL二进制日志文件。读者将了解到mysqlbinlog的强大功能,以及如何利用它来进行数据库恢复、数据审计和复制监控等工作。原创 2024-05-29 12:16:53 · 17189 阅读 · 0 评论 -
深入解析MySQL 8中的角色与用户管理
本文将深入探讨MySQL 8中的角色和用户管理功能。MySQL 8引入了角色(Role)的概念,使得权限管理变得更加灵活和高效。通过本文,读者将了解如何创建和管理用户,如何定义和分配角色,以及如何利用这些功能提升数据库的安全性和管理效率。具体示例将帮助读者在实际工作中应用这些知识。原创 2024-05-28 12:27:19 · 15374 阅读 · 0 评论 -
MySQL触发器实战:自动执行的秘密
本文将详细介绍MySQL中的触发器,触发器是一种在特定事件发生时自动执行的数据库对象,能够极大地简化数据操作。本文将从触发器的基本概念和创建方法入手,逐步深入到触发器的使用场景和高级应用。通过具体实例展示如何利用触发器实现自动化的数据处理和维护,读者将学习到如何在实际项目中有效地应用触发器。原创 2024-05-28 12:27:03 · 15503 阅读 · 0 评论 -
解密MySQL中的临时表:探究临时表的神奇用途
本文将深入探讨MySQL数据库中的重要功能——临时表。我们将介绍临时表的定义、用途和分类,并探讨在实际应用中如何使用临时表来优化查询性能和简化数据操作。通过论文的学习,读者将能够全面了解MySQL中临时表的特点和优势,从而更好地利用临时表解决实际的数据管理问题。原创 2024-05-27 12:17:11 · 16671 阅读 · 0 评论 -
MySQL 8窗口函数详解:高效数据处理的必备技能
本文将详细介绍MySQL 8中的窗口函数。窗口函数是SQL中强大的数据分析工具,能够帮助我们进行复杂的统计和分析操作。本文将介绍窗口函数的定义、基本语法和常用类型,并通过实例展示如何在实际应用中使用窗口函数进行数据分析。读者将学习到如何利用窗口函数提升查询效率,简化复杂的数据处理任务。原创 2024-05-27 12:16:54 · 16570 阅读 · 2 评论 -
MySQL魔法秀:揭秘常用字符串函数的神奇操作
本文将深入探讨MySQL数据库中常用的字符串函数,涵盖字符串拼接、截取、替换、转换大小写等多种操作。我们将详细介绍每个函数的用法、参数和实际应用场景,帮助读者充分利用这些函数处理文本数据。原创 2024-05-13 12:51:14 · 15229 阅读 · 0 评论 -
解码MySQL条件宝典:常用条件判断函数的完整指南
本文将深入探讨MySQL数据库中常用的条件判断函数,涵盖IF、CASE WHEN、COALESCE等多种函数。我们将详细介绍每个函数的用法、语法和实际应用场景,帮助读者充分利用这些函数进行复杂的逻辑控制。原创 2024-05-11 12:40:54 · 16225 阅读 · 0 评论 -
条件筛选大作战:解析Where与Having的区别与应用
本文将深入探讨SQL中常用的条件筛选语句,即Where与Having。我们将解析它们的用法、区别和最佳实践,帮助读者更好地理解和应用这两个关键的SQL语句。原创 2024-05-11 12:40:30 · 15247 阅读 · 0 评论 -
探索MySQL数学宝库:常用数学函数的秘密操作
本文将深入探讨MySQL数据库中常用的数学函数,包括绝对值、取整、四舍五入、对数、指数等多种函数。我们将详细介绍每个函数的用法、参数和实际应用场景,帮助读者充分利用这些函数处理数字数据。原创 2024-05-09 12:24:44 · 14857 阅读 · 1 评论 -
解析ProxySQL的故障转移机制
本文将深入探讨ProxySQL在数据库架构中的故障转移机制,以及如何保障数据库系统的高可用性。我们将详细介绍ProxySQL的故障检测和切换策略,帮助读者了解如何配置和优化ProxySQL,确保数据库系统的稳定运行。原创 2024-05-09 12:23:26 · 15781 阅读 · 0 评论 -
mysql从库SHOW SLAVE STATUS字段详解
本文将深入解析MySQL中`SHOW SLAVE STATUS`命令返回的各个字段含义,详细解释每个字段的作用和意义。无论您是初学者还是有经验的数据库管理员,都能通过本文全面了解MySQL从服务器状态的相关信息,从而更好地监控和管理MySQL数据库的同步复制过程。原创 2024-05-06 12:39:13 · 1838 阅读 · 0 评论 -
你真的知道Show Master Status吗?
本文将深入探讨MySQL中`SHOW MASTER STATUS`命令所返回的字段含义,详细解释每个字段代表的意义和作用。无论您是初学者还是有经验的数据库管理员,都能通过本文全面了解MySQL主服务器状态的相关信息,从而更好地监控和管理MySQL数据库。原创 2024-05-06 12:37:10 · 15941 阅读 · 0 评论 -
mysql主从复制,从搭建到使用
本文将深入探讨MySQL主从复制的实现原理、配置步骤和实际应用场景。无论您是初学者还是有经验的数据库管理员,都能通过本文全面了解MySQL主从复制技术,并学会如何在实际项目中应用,从而提高数据库的可用性和性能。原创 2024-04-28 12:55:29 · 15202 阅读 · 0 评论 -
数据库同步革命:MySQL GTID模式下主从配置的全面解析
本文将深入探讨MySQL GTID(全局事务标识)模式下主从配置的步骤、原理和最佳实践。无论您是初学者还是有经验的数据库管理员,都能通过本文全面了解MySQL GTID模式下主从复制技术,从而提高数据库的可用性和灵活性。原创 2024-04-26 19:54:03 · 1830 阅读 · 0 评论 -
探秘MySQL主从复制的多种实现方式
本文将深入探讨MySQL主从复制的多种实现方式,包括基于语句、基于行和混合模式等。无论您是初学者还是有经验的数据库管理员,都能通过本文全面了解MySQL主从复制技术的多样化选择,从而提高数据库的可用性和性能。原创 2024-04-26 19:52:36 · 1197 阅读 · 0 评论 -
轻松搭建MySQL 8.0:Ubuntu上的完美指南
本文将详细介绍在Ubuntu操作系统上搭建MySQL 8.0数据库的步骤和方法。无论您是新手还是有经验的开发者,都能够通过本文轻松掌握搭建MySQL 8.0的技巧,为您的项目提供可靠的数据库支持。原创 2024-04-25 20:11:30 · 15656 阅读 · 0 评论 -
MySQL权限管理大揭秘:用户、组、权限解析
本文将深入探讨MySQL中的用户、组和权限管理,帮助读者全面了解MySQL数据库的权限控制机制。我们将详细介绍MySQL中用户和组的创建与管理方法,以及如何分配和控制用户的权限,从而确保数据库的安全性和稳定性。原创 2024-04-24 12:53:17 · 1499 阅读 · 0 评论 -
自定义mybatis插件实现读写分离
使用mybatis实现读写分离插件原创 2024-04-24 12:52:20 · 15738 阅读 · 0 评论 -
数据库轻松切换:解读Spring中的AbstractRoutingDataSource
本文将深入探讨Spring框架中的AbstractRoutingDataSource,这是实现多数据源动态切换的关键组件。我们将详细介绍AbstractRoutingDataSource的原理、使用方法和实际应用场景,帮助读者更好地理解和使用这一重要功能。原创 2024-04-23 17:37:06 · 16368 阅读 · 0 评论 -
代码层面的读写分离vs使用proxysql
本文将比较Spring Boot代码层面实现数据库读写分离与使用ProxySQL管理读写分离的优缺点、适用场景和操作方法。通过对比这两种方法的原理、配置和实际应用效果,读者将更好地了解如何在项目中选择合适的读写分离方案。原创 2024-04-23 17:35:30 · 1455 阅读 · 0 评论 -
MySQL慢查询日志配置指南:发现性能瓶颈,提升数据库效率
本文将深入探讨MySQL慢查询日志的配置方法和作用。我们将解释如何启用和配置MySQL慢查询日志,以及如何分析日志文件,发现潜在的数据库性能问题,并提出优化建议,从而提升数据库的效率和性能。原创 2024-04-16 12:24:45 · 16531 阅读 · 0 评论 -
mybatis自制插件+注解实现数据脱敏
数据安全是每个应用程序都必须面对的挑战之一。本文将介绍如何利用 MyBatis 自制插件和注解来实现数据脱敏,保护敏感信息的安全性。通过结合插件和注解的强大功能,我们可以在数据库层面上对数据进行实时脱敏处理,从而确保用户隐私的安全性。原创 2024-04-15 12:24:52 · 15416 阅读 · 0 评论 -
MyBatis-Plus如何娴熟运用乐观锁
本文将引领读者进入MyBatis-Plus的乐观锁之旅,通过生动的例子和详细解释,深入研究乐观锁在数据库操作中的实现原理和MyBatis-Plus中的应用方式。让我们共同揭开这个数据乐章的面纱,探索其中的奥秘。原创 2024-03-08 17:34:50 · 16125 阅读 · 0 评论 -
事务隔离大揭秘:MySQL中的四种隔离级别解析
在这篇博客中,我们将深入研究MySQL数据库中的事务隔离级别。通过探讨不同隔离级别的特点,我们将揭示在多用户环境中如何确保数据库事务的一致性、隔离性、持久性和原子性。从简单到复杂,我们将逐级展开,让您深入了解MySQL事务处理的内部工作原理。原创 2024-02-26 12:36:19 · 5612 阅读 · 0 评论 -
MySQL锁三部曲:临键、间隙与记录的奇妙旅程
本文深入研究了MySQL中的三种重要锁类型:临键锁、间隙锁和记录锁。通过详细的分析和实例,读者将能够更好地理解这些锁的工作原理,为优化数据库并发性提供实用的指导。原创 2024-02-25 21:33:20 · 1234 阅读 · 0 评论 -
数据安全之路:深入了解MySQL的行锁与表锁机制
本文深入研究了MySQL数据库中行锁与表锁的实现方式,比较了它们的特点与适用场景。通过详细的分析和实例演示,读者将能够更好地理解如何在数据库中使用行锁和表锁以确保数据的安全性和性能。原创 2024-02-25 21:30:22 · 1110 阅读 · 0 评论 -
索引大战:探秘InnoDB数据库中B树和Hash索引的优劣
本文深入研究了InnoDB存储引擎中B树和Hash索引的实现方式,比较了它们在不同场景下的性能表现。通过详细的分析和实例,读者将能够更好地理解选择何种索引类型以提高数据库性能的决策。原创 2024-02-23 13:00:16 · 986 阅读 · 0 评论 -
树中枝繁叶茂:探索 B+ 树、B 树、二叉树、红黑树和跳表的世界
这篇博客将深入研究常见的树状数据结构,包括 B+ 树、B 树、二叉树、红黑树和跳表。我们将解析它们的结构、特点以及在软件开发中的应用。通过本文,读者将更好地理解这些数据结构在存储、搜索和插入操作上的优势和不同之处。原创 2024-02-23 12:59:07 · 1012 阅读 · 0 评论 -
解谜MySQL索引:优化查询速度的不二法门
在这篇博客中,我们将探讨MySQL中不同类型的索引,了解它们如何提升数据库性能。从基础概念到高级技巧,你将获得全面的知识,让你能够更好地设计和优化数据库索引,提升系统的响应速度。原创 2024-02-22 12:48:36 · 842 阅读 · 0 评论 -
MySQL引擎对决:深入解析MyISAM和InnoDB的区别
本文将深入探讨MySQL两种常见存储引擎——MyISAM和InnoDB的差异。通过对比它们在性能、事务支持、锁机制等方面的特性,读者将能够更好地了解何时选择哪种引擎以满足特定需求,并避免潜在的数据库瓶颈。原创 2024-02-22 12:47:40 · 1509 阅读 · 0 评论 -
MySQL Redo Log解密:事务故事的幕后英雄
本篇博客将带你深入MySQL的Redo Log,揭示它在数据库事务中的关键角色。通过对Redo Log的解析,你将理解其如何确保数据一致性和事务持久性,为MySQL数据库的高性能提供坚实保障。原创 2023-11-28 17:24:09 · 1254 阅读 · 1 评论 -
MySQL Binlog实战:在生产环境中的应用与最佳实践【实战应用】
通过实际的生产案例,本篇博客将深入讨论如何在真实的MySQL生产环境中应用和管理Binlog。探索一些最佳实践,帮助你更好地利用Binlog确保数据库的稳定性和可靠性。原创 2023-11-28 17:22:51 · 16705 阅读 · 0 评论 -
MySQL Binlog深度解析:进阶应用与实战技巧【进阶应用】
本篇博客将深入挖掘MySQL Binlog的高级特性,讨论其在数据库管理中的实际应用以及一些进阶的使用技巧。通过实际案例和示例,带你更深入地了解和应用Binlog。原创 2023-11-27 17:48:51 · 1955 阅读 · 3 评论 -
解析MySQL Binlog:从零开始的入门指南【binlog入门指南】
初学者友好的MySQL Binlog入门指南,深入研究什么是Binlog以及它在MySQL中的作用。我们将从基础知识开始,逐步引导你进入这个强大而神秘的MySQL特性。原创 2023-11-26 19:14:44 · 2638 阅读 · 4 评论 -
Binlog vs. Redo Log:数据库日志的较劲【高级】
本篇博客将引领你深入研究MySQL中的两个关键日志类型:Binlog和Redo Log。通过对比它们的功能、结构以及在数据库事务中的作用,你将更好地理解数据库引擎的运行机制,为优化性能和确保数据一致性打下坚实基础。原创 2023-11-26 19:03:49 · 1301 阅读 · 2 评论